Subject: Key rotation — reminder job

The appointment reminder job for the Larchmere Clinic portal had its key rotated this morning; the old one stops working Friday. Please review PR 88, which swaps the config reference and adds a startup check. Nothing else in the job changed. The new key for the internal notification service is below — confirm it matches what's in the vault entry.

service key, fawip-bajef: kto11_Qt5wZK9vdNC

## Releases

Heads up for the sync: Lanternfeed exports now pin timestamps to the workspace timezone instead of UTC, so the "my report is 5 hours off" tickets should dry up. Old exports stay as-is; we're not backfilling. The 3.8 release bundle ships Friday. Verify the tarball against the release key below.

rollout seal: bky4_x7Gc

### Action Item 4: Audit wiki role assignments

During the Larkvale incident, a contractor account retained editor rights on the Opsline wiki three months after offboarding, which allowed the stale runbook edit that misdirected responders. Owner: platform team, due end of quarter. As the incoming contractor, you'll receive viewer access by default; request elevation only per-space, and expect a 90-day expiry on all grants. The access request workflow and role matrix are documented on the internal page linked below.

dashboard of hadug-bajef = https://superset.crelvonet.corp/settings/display/ticket/view/secrets/display/pipeline/ff837826542183d07687e3ad

## Data Stores: EXIF Scrubbing

Heads up for reviewers: the Pellgram upload path strips EXIF before anything touches disk. GPS tags, serials, and timestamps all go; orientation is preserved and baked into the pixels. Scrub results land in the `scrub_audit` table so we can prove a given blob was cleaned. If a PR touches the scrubber, spot-check a few audit rows in the metadata database via the connection string below.

primary connection of yagep-kahip = redis://giliel_svc:zYiKsLL2PLpfPL@db-348f.xolmarsys.corp:5432/fenwyn